| Shake-up on Offensive line???? On the first day of practice this week, coach Mike McCarthy made it clear neither Daryn Colledge nor Jason Spitz is assured of starting at the two guard spots after poor performances in last week's win over the Kansas City Chiefs. The guards are an especially big issue this week, because Minnesota has perhaps the best defensive-tackle tandem in the NFL in run-stopper Pat Williams and all-around playmaker Kevin Williams. Anything less than a decent performance against them could be a major problem for the Packers' offense not only in the run game but also passing.
